Situated in Sandown on the south eastern coast of the picturesque Isle of Wight, the hotel is on the High Street just two minutes walk from the three miles of safe, sandy beaches of Sandown Bay alongside its twin resort of Shanklin,

Sandown has a character all of its own with the High Street situated close to the promenade. Among the local attractions are the Tiger and Lemur Sanctuary, Dinosaur Isle, Browns Golf Course, pitch and putt, crazy golf, the pier, arcades, trampolines and a children's playground. There are parks and gardens to enjoy and in the town you can watch the art of glass making at Glory Art Glass.

Should you feel the need to exercise you can visit the Heights Leisure Centre situated at the top of the High Street with its indoor pool, gym and squash courts.
